NVDA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

5,193 of the 7,593 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NVIDIA (NVDA)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$2.15T — up 13% from $1.9T a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 752 funds opened new NVDA positions and 87 closed out — a net gain of 665 holders — while 2,108 added to existing stakes and 2,054 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$5.24B.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$9.68B.
